Understanding Your DeWalt 18V Battery Pack
Before diving into the rebuilding process, it’s important to understand what a DeWalt 18V battery pack is and how it functions. This battery pack is typically composed of multiple individual cells lined up in series to deliver the desired voltage. Over time, these cells can degrade, leading to diminished performance. Various factors contribute to battery deterioration, including:
- Age: Like all things, batteries have a lifespan. Most battery packs can last anywhere from 2 to 5 years, depending on usage.
- Charge Cycles: A charge cycle is defined as a complete discharge and recharge. Frequent charging and discharging can wear out the cells faster.

Rebuilding Process: A Step-by-Step Guide
Now, let’s delve into the step-by-step process of rebuilding your DeWalt 18V battery pack. Follow these steps carefully to ensure safety and success.
Step 1: Safety First
Before you start, wear your safety goggles and gloves. Lithium-ion batteries contain hazardous materials and can be dangerous if mishandled. Ensure you are working in a well-ventilated area to avoid inhaling fumes.
Step 2: Disassemble the Battery Pack
Using your Philips head screwdriver, carefully unscrew the casing of the battery pack. Gently pry it open to avoid damaging the plastic casing. Once opened, note the arrangement of the cells and wires. Taking a photo at this stage can help you remember how to reassemble it later.
Step 3: Remove the Old Cells
Next, take your wire cutters and carefully remove the solder holding the old battery cells together. Make sure to label or keep track of the positive and negative terminals on each cell as you proceed. Dispose of the old cells according to local regulations.
Step 4: Prepare the New Battery Cells
After removing the old cells, prepare your new replacement cells. If they are not pre-assembled, connect them in the same configuration as the old cells. Use a multimeter to confirm that each cell is functional and properly charged before proceeding.
Step 5: Soldering the New Cells
Carefully solder the terminals of the new cells together in the same configuration as the old ones. Make sure the connections are secure to prevent any future failures. Use electrical tape to wrap the connections and ensure that there are no exposed wires.
Step 6: Reassemble the Battery Pack
Once all cells are connected and secured, gently close the battery pack casing. Make sure all the wires are properly routed to prevent pinching or damage. Screw the casing back together, ensuring all screws are tight but not overly so.
Step 7: Testing the Rebuilt Battery Pack
Before putting your newly rebuilt battery pack to use, it’s crucial to test it:
- Use a multimeter to check the voltage of your rebuilt cells. A healthy 18V battery should read between 18.5V to 20V.
- Insert the battery pack into the tool and perform a quick performance test to see how well it functions.
Common Issues and Troubleshooting
Occasionally, you may face issues after rebuilding your battery pack. Here are a few common troubles and their potential solutions:
Issue: Inconsistent Power Output
If you notice your tool surging or not running smoothly, it could mean that some cells are not performing as expected. Double-check your soldering connections and ensure that all new cells are functioning properly.
Issue: Battery Not Charging
If your rebuilt battery pack isn’t charging, confirm that all connections are secure. Check the charging port and the voltage of each individual cell using a multimeter. If one cell is significantly lower than the others, it could impact the overall performance.

Can I use different brands of batteries for the rebuild?
While it is technically possible to use different brands of batteries for your DeWalt 18V battery pack rebuild, it is not recommended. Each brand may have different specifications, such as voltage ratings and chemistry, which can lead to compatibility issues. Using batteries from different manufacturers may result in inconsistent performance, reduced longevity, or, in some cases, potential safety hazards due to mismatched charging cycles.
Sticking to the same brand or even the same type of cell (like NiCd or Li-ion) ensures compatibility and safety while maximizing performance. Always make sure to check the specifications of the new cells to ensure they meet the requirements of your DeWalt device. This adherence guarantees a smoother operation and longer lifespan for your rebuilt battery pack.
How do I know if my battery pack needs rebuilding?
Several signs indicate it might be time for a rebuild of your DeWalt 18V battery pack. One of the most common signs is a noticeable decline in performance, such as reduced run time or frequent discharges. If you find that your tools are not lasting as long as they used to during use, this is often a strong indicator that the battery cells inside the pack are failing and may need replacement or rebuilding.
Another sign is physical damage or swelling of the battery pack. If you observe any swelling, leakage, or corrosion around the terminals, this is a significant warning that the cells have deteriorated. In such cases, not only is rebuilding recommended, but it may also be necessary to dispose of the battery safely due to potential chemical hazards. Regular checks of battery health can help catch such issues early, allowing for timely rebuilding and ensuring continued functionality of your tools.
